UFOs in the orchard

Photo by Matt Milkovich

Have you seen a UFO in a cherry orchard? Here is a look at a high-efficiency growing system for sweet cherries called the UFO, short for Upright Fruiting Offshoots. Check the April edition of FGN for more information on the UFO system.
